I don't at all find the interior "plasticky".. especially compared to other vehicles in its class. It's got that "built in Japan" look and feel. Neither the Cruze, Focus, nor Elantra... to say nothing about the Civic and Corolla.. can be had with must-have features (for me) like HID projector headlights and LED taillights. The swiveling left/right of the headlights when you turn is an added bonus.

I'm also not thrilled with the Focus's dual clutch transmission or the intrusiveness of its My Ford Touch system.. the Cruze's boringness.. or the Elantra's way-too-overwrought styling. The smiley face on new Mazdas may be polarizing; something people either love or hate, but it doesn't try too hard to be different-but-likable like the Elantra does.
